Product Ideas for Your Small Shop
When evaluating a new embroidery file, I always brainstorm where it will look best. The versatility of Mermaid Christmas allows it to shine on various substrates. Here are several product ideas that could drive sales for your craft business:
- Sweatshirt Embroidery: Place the design on the left chest of a crewneck sweatshirt or larger on the back of a hoodie. The contrast of a whimsical mermaid against cozy winter fabric creates a trendy, boutique-style look.
- Tote Bag Design: Canvas tote bags are perennial bestsellers. Embroidering this design on a natural or white canvas bag makes for a fantastic gift item. It is practical, reusable, and showcases the stitch work clearly.
- Kitchen Towel Embroidery: Holiday kitchen linens are huge sellers in November and December. A mermaid motif adds a splash of fun to neutral-colored towels, making them perfect for hostess gifts.
- Baby Embroidery Items: If the design scales down well, it could be adorable on baby blankets or onesies. Parents love unique holiday outfits for photo shoots, and a mermaid theme is distinct from the usual elf or reindeer options.
- Embroidered Patch: If you have the capability to create patches, this design could be turned into an iron-on accessory. Patches are low-commitment purchases for customers and great add-ons at checkout.

Practical Notes for Embroidery Sellers
Before adding any new design to your shop, there are technical steps you must take to ensure quality. While the description highlights the stylish nature of the design, it does not provide specific technical details. Therefore, it is essential to confirm the following on the Creative Fabrica product page before purchase:
- Hoop Size: Check which hoop sizes are included. Ensure the design fits the hoops you commonly use for your products, whether that is a 4x4 inch hoop for patches or a 5x7 inch hoop for towels.
- Stitch Density: Review the stitch count and density. High-density designs may require specific stabilizers to prevent puckering, especially on lighter fabrics like t-shirts or kitchen towels. Always test on similar fabric before selling.
- File Formats: Confirm that the digital embroidery file includes formats compatible with your machine (such as PES, DST, or JEF).
- Licensing Terms: Always review the license agreement. Most Creative Fabrica designs allow for commercial use on finished physical products, but verifying this protects your small shop owners status and ensures you are compliant.
Once you have the file, create a sample stitch-out. Test different thread colors to see what combination offers the best contrast and vibrancy. Sometimes, swapping a standard red for a coral or a deep teal can modernize the look. Photograph this sample on real fabric to gauge how the texture interacts with the stitches. This step is vital for creating accurate social media previews and managing customer expectations.
